Abstract
The utility model discloses a kind of solar thermoelectric coproduction devices, including case is fixedly mounted, the inside that case is fixedly mounted is fixedly installed with rotary electric machine, the output shaft of the rotary electric machine is fixedly installed with first gear, rotary supporting rod is provided on the left of the rotary electric machine, the outer surface of the rotary supporting rod is fixedly installed with second gear, first bearing is fixedly installed at the top of the fixed installation case, the top of the rotary supporting rod runs through the inner wall of first bearing and extends to the outside that case is fixedly mounted, connecting rod is provided with above the rotary supporting rod.The utility model, start rotary electric machine, so that first gear drives second gear to be rotated, so that flat plate collector also may be rotated with solar panels, the position for turning to direct sunlight stops operating motor, the direction that flat plate collector and solar panels can arbitrarily be adjusted allows solar thermoelectric coproduction device adequately using luminous energy, and conversion ratio is higher.
